Natural disasters come from our Earth's natural processes and can cause a lot of harm to people,
animals, and places. Among various kinds of natural disasters, earthquakes seem to be unpredictable and
more dangerous. An earthquake happens when there is a sudden release of energy in the Earth's crust,
making the ground shake. Most large earthquakes occur around the edges of the Pacific Ocean.
Sometimes, earthquakes can be very strong and cause buildings to fall or roads to break. They can also
cause people to get hurt or even lose their lives. For example, in 1976, an earthquake in the city of
Tangshan, China resulted in the deaths of approximately 242,000 people, and the city was almost entirely
destroyed. It is considered one of the deadliest earthquakes in recorded history.
Although it is really difficult to give warnings about earthquakes, people ensure their safety
through some tips. When an earthquake happens, stay away from windows, get under a table or desk, and
hold on. After the shaking stops, it's also important to be careful of things that might have fallen or be
ready to fall. Everyone should know about earthquakes and have a plan to stay safe.
